Step 2: Start Fundraising

o Upload contacts into your account and start sending emails to your friends, family and colleagues.

o There are two email templates already created or you can start from scratch. Either way, a link to your personalized fundraising page will be included. Ask your closest friends and family to donate first. An empty page can be a bit intimidating, so

having a couple of donations on the page should encourage other donors. Email your other contacts in groups — colleagues, running club, friends overseas, etc -

personalizing your message each time. Get creative! Come up with a fun subject line to entice people to open your email. Tuesday, Wednesday and Thursday are the best days to send emails between 10 am – 2 pm.

o When a donor uses your personalized page to donate, your thermometer will be automatically updated

and you’ll be that much closer to your goals.

o Offline Pledges: You can also track offline pledges on your page. When Can Do MS receives your checks or cash, we will confirm the donation.

Prepare

o Set goals and set aside time to achieve them. o Gather information on who you will be contacting including email, phone number and address. If it’s not

someone you already know well, do a little research to get a sense of the potential donor’s giving ability and tendencies.

o Make a contribution yourself so you know what it feels like (hint: it feels good!), so you understand the psychology of giving, and so you have more credibility in asking.

Meet in Person, If Possible

o Set meetings to be respectful of the potential donor’s time. o Bring materials, such as brochures and other promotional materials. We can provide these for you! o Say your name, and what you’re raising money for: "Hello, my name is Jane Jones, and I’m

participating in Vertical Express for Can Do MS to raise money for people and families living with multiple sclerosis."

Describe Can Do MS's Programs and its Effectiveness

o “A national nonprofit organization, Can Do Multiple Sclerosis is an innovative provider of lifestyle empowerment programs for people with MS and their support partners. The organization empowers people to move beyond their condition by giving them the knowledge, skills, tools and confidence to adopt healthy lifestyle behaviors, actively co-manage their MS and live their best lives.”

o In 2011, Can Do MS provided programs and services to over 14,000 people living with MS and at little or no cost to the program participant.

o Can Do MS has received five consecutive four star ratings from independent non-profit evaluator, Charity Navigator for demonstrating fiscal responsibility.

o Over 80% of funds raised go directly to our lifestyle empowerment programs.

Asking for Money - The Pitch o Always ask for a specific amount of money. o Let them know their donation is tax deductible. o Smile - stop talking. Wait for a response. Listen. o Answer questions briefly. o Explain why we need the money now. “Money raised at this year’s Vertical Express events will help

launch a new multi-day program for people and families with MS.” Say Thank You or Ask for Follow Up

o Thank the donor for their gift and their time. If they do not make a gift, thank them for their time. o If you receive a donation, verbally thank them on the spot. Follow up with a handwritten note of thanks. o If they say no, thank them for their time and consideration. Ask why, if it’s not too awkward. Maybe

they’d like to be involved in some other way – donate time, or materials – or perhaps the timing is wrong this year, but they’d be interested in the future if you approach them at a different time of year, etc.

o If a donor is undecided, ask if you may follow up with them. Do so within an appropriate time period. On the following page, you will find an editable sample fundraising letter to help you with your ask.

MORE SOCIAL MEDIA TIPS!

Your friends can help you raise money without even donating! Encourage them to share your posts and emails with their friends to help you reach new people! Have fun with it, eveeveryone enjoys a good laugh.

Include pics in your post & always tag us by typing an @ symbol before our name. People tend to like/comment/share pictures more which

expands your post’s reach!

Find a donor or company willing to match

donations you receive over a certain time period. People love when their donation magically doubles!
